pattern_tap VS pipes

Compare pattern_tap vs pipes and see what are their differences.

pattern_tap

Macro for tapping into a pattern match while using the pipe operator (by mgwidmann)

pipes

Macros for more flexible composition with the Elixir Pipe operator (by batate)
Our great sponsors
  • WorkOS - The modern identity platform for B2B SaaS
  • InfluxDB - Power Real-Time Data Analytics at Scale
  • SaaSHub - Software Alternatives and Reviews
pattern_tap pipes
1 -
58 328
- -
0.0 0.0
almost 7 years ago over 5 years ago
Elixir Elixir
MIT License Apache License 2.0
The number of mentions indicates the total number of mentions that we've tracked plus the number of user suggested alternatives.
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.

pattern_tap

Posts with mentions or reviews of pattern_tap. We have used some of these posts to build our list of alternatives and similar projects. The last one was on 2021-05-19.

pipes

Posts with mentions or reviews of pipes. We have used some of these posts to build our list of alternatives and similar projects.

We haven't tracked posts mentioning pipes yet.
Tracking mentions began in Dec 2020.

What are some alternatives?

When comparing pattern_tap and pipes you can also consider the following projects:

backports - Ensure backwards compatibility even if newer functions are used

mdef - Easily define multiple function heads in elixir

named_args - Allows named arg style arguments in Elixir

ok_jose - Pipe elixir functions that match ok/error tuples or custom patterns.

happy - the alchemist's happy path with elixir

pipe_to - The enhanced elixir pipe operator which can specify the target position

OK - Elegant error/exception handling in Elixir, with result monads.

Bang - Bang simply adds dynamic bang! functions to your existing module functions with after-callback.

kwfuns - Functions with syntax for keyword arguments and defaults